Song Young-gil accuses Han Dong-hoon of backward politics like a private investigator or broker

Song Young-gil has pushed back against Han Dong-hoon after the independent lawmaker released text messages connected to an alleged request for help securing approval for a new drug and mentioned Songโ€™s name.

Song said the messages contained what he called boastful statements by a person he did not know, with the names of numerous politicians from both parties reportedly appearing in the exchanges. He accused Han of selectively publishing part of a one-sided conversation in an attempt to damage his reputation.

He is trying to damage my reputation by selectively releasing part of a one-sided conversation.

In a Facebook post, Song also revived allegations against Han from his time as a special investigations prosecutor and justice minister. He accused Han of being associated with allegations involving fabricated or concealed evidence and the publication of alleged criminal facts. Song said Han was repeating the same conduct as a lawmaker and should end what he called backward politics resembling the work of a private investigator or broker.

Han had released messages exchanged by businessman Yang, who is linked to the alleged drug-approval lobbying, and Kang, the founder of biotech company Genencell. Han said the messages mentioned a lawmaker identified as โ€œChoi,โ€ another as โ€œKim,โ€ and Song Young-gil, and he called the affair the โ€œDemocratic Party brothersโ€™ gate.โ€ Song demanded that Han disclose specifically how he obtained the investigative records.

I hope Han Dong-hoon overcomes his identity crisis and decides whether he is still the special investigations prosecutor favored by Yoon Suk Yeol or a lawmaker constitutionally obliged to protect due process.
